Buying Guide

Key purchase considerations for welding auto body projects include the type of welding method, the intended repairs, and the user’s experience level. Stud welders excel at pulling dents from steel panels with controlled force, while butt welding clamps aid in patching and aligning sheets for seamless seams. When selecting tools, consider durability, heat resistance, and ergonomic grip to reduce fatigue during longer sessions. For beginners, a combination of educational resources and a versatile starter kit can smooth the learning curve. For professionals, prioritize high-temperature tolerance, precise control, and compatibility with common auto body gauge materials. Safety gear, including welding helmets, gloves, and protective clothing, should accompany all purchases.
